Autism or Autism spectrum disorder

Autism also named aut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a complicated condition that contains problems with communication and behavior. People with autism have trouble with communication. People with Autism have trouble understanding what other people think and feel about them. Autism spectrum disorder is a disorder associated to brain development that effects how a person witnesses and socializes with others causing problems in social interaction and communication. The disorder also covers limited and repetitive patterns of behavior.

Common symptoms of autism include:

  • A lack of eye contact
  • A thin range of interests or deep interest in certain topics
  • High sensitivity to touch, smells, or sights that appear ordinary to other people.
